FORT BRAGG, N.C. — A soldier died on Fort Bragg on Friday morning when they were hit by a vehicle.

A spokesperson said a soldier was crossing the intersection of Knox Street and Honeycutt Road around 10 a.m. when they were hit.

“We are deeply saddened by the death of one of our own in the recent accident that occurred this morning on Fort Bragg,” said Lt. Col. David Olson, Spokesman, XVIII Airborne Corps and Fort Bragg.

This crash is currently under investigation.

The soldier's identity was not released.
